About Xander
Xander is a striking black cat with a short coat and impressive extra toes—a true polydactyl with charm to spare. At five years old, he's come a long way from his feral days, having first been rescued and adopted out as a both indoor and outdoor companion. After a challenging turn in his previous person's life, Xander found himself back in foster care, where he quickly reminded everyone he belongs indoors, basking in company and comfort. He may start out shy around new faces, but it doesn't last; he settles in and bonds fast. Xander is calm, undemanding, and cool most of the time, but when the vibe is right he'll dash about the house and show off his playful side. His extra toes are great for batting toys, and he gets along well with other cats, making him a solid fit for multi-feline households. Xander's hoping for a stable, loving home where his gentle and quirky spirit will be treasured.
